WOO warm weather means i can start working on the car again. Here we go,

This time on Project Blue Bird:

front radiator support and mounts have been removed, finally, for replacement. The actual radiator support itself is not bad so i'll be wire brushing it and painting it to make it look fresh. The mounts were not too bad but they were awful enough to merit replacement. While doing this, i noticed "Shredded Mozzarella" in my motor mounts, telling me i did too many burnouts. So, as anyone would to, i pulled the engine out for further prep work until parts come in. 

This is where things got worse

In the photo attached, i've circled the area that's been rotted out because of a bad Heater Core. At first, i saw the rotted out toe board which seemed to be an easy enough fix. Unfortunately i jinxed myself when i found that the Acidic Antifreeze ate through all three layers of steel by the toe board. If you look, you can see the red mount from the Energy Suspension Part going into that frame-body connection point. The structure point of the car i guess. I've drawn out what's happening with the metal with my handy MS paint skills below. 

I have no idea how i'm going to fix this at all....

Curtis, to expound on what Frosty said. For all the work it appears you will need to put in, I would suggest you replace everything you can with new good sheet metal. Whatever you can take apart at a seam, do so and spot weld. Any upset angle of new sheet metal you can include, do so. This would include the floor if need be. 

Your sheet metal rot is not from an antifreeze leak. Antifreeze corrosion when spilled or leaked, even when hot, corrodes very little. One of the highest corrosion rates of antifreeze on a metal is aluminum, but that is under a circulating coolant system. 

https://apps.dtic.mil/dtic/tr/fulltext/u2/466284.pdf

this attachment is a unclassified document from Wright-Patterson Airforce base that studied the effects of ethylene glycol corrosion on materials for use in space as a heat transfer medium. 

I don’t know where your bird spent it’s life, but that corrosion is clearly from road salt or if it came from the south, in a red clay area.

Curtis, well yes and no. Depending on what, where and how you cut, sheet metal will warp or it won’t! In the case of my wife’s “74” all I really used was the roof, tops of the rear quarters and half of the upper pillar post. Would it have been cheaper to find a new car? Maybe, but it would not have had a full frame and all the geometrical weight shifts I made to allow this car to handle.

If you look, all the upset edges, double layers sheet metal, and back window structure were left in place. This held the rear quarters together. The front pillar posts are a triple structured arch with an inner roof panel to hold that whole structure together. When I put the pillar post halves together I inserted a ½ SS rod about 12” long into the hollow channel that exists, then welded them together. In this way any collision that might occur would never be able to compromise the welds of thin sheet metal. The most damaged part of this car was basically the lower firewall/frame mount area and front floor, similar to what you have found.

And it was going so smoothly. 

While working on the car, buttoning up loose bolts, prepping areas for paints and general placements, he wanted to take a look at the engine, which was sitting on the Engine stand and flipped over. He looked around, asking about the crankshaft and what-not. pointing out a lean oil pickup tube too. It wasn't long before i wanted to show him how tall the engine was going to be with the new carb, intake and etc. So when i rotated the engine to Right Side Up, oil poured out of cylinder 5 spark plug hole. That would explain why there was always a fouled plug and blue smoke behind me. So, new set of piston rings? Nope.

Unfortunately, it got worse once we took the cylinder heads off. We found scoring and deep scratches in cylinder walls all through the block. The culprit? the Damned Spectre Oil Pan. i think it's called a splash shield (?) that cracked and with the vibrations, the seam from the crack rubbed together creating metal flakes in the oil. 

im praying that a simple honing could solve this, since buying new pistons for a new overbore, let alone get it to a machine shop, is not within my budget.

Curtis, just in case you’re unaware, you can buy oversized piston rings in incremental sizes, .003, .005 etc., but you’re going to have to dismantle the engine to hone it. In the end a bare block hauled to a shop and new pistons and rings may be the better choice. Honing can be tricky when it comes to true roundness and a straight bore! More often than not anything more than glaze busting will leave a block out of round and tapered.
